What is the best blood thinner?

Published in Blood Thinners 4 mins read

There isn't one single "best" blood thinner, as the most effective choice depends entirely on an individual's specific medical condition, overall health, and unique circumstances. The "best" blood thinner is the one that provides the most benefit while minimizing risks for a particular patient.

Understanding Blood Thinners: Anticoagulants vs. Antiplatelets

Blood thinners are medications that reduce the blood's ability to form clots. They are broadly categorized into two main types based on how they work:

Anticoagulants

These medications primarily target clotting factors in the blood, prolonging the time it takes for a clot to form. They are used to prevent and treat conditions like deep vein thrombosis (DVT), pulmonary embolism (PE), and stroke in people with atrial fibrillation (AFib).

Warfarin (Coumadin®)

Warfarin is a long-standing anticoagulant that has been a cornerstone of clot prevention for decades. It is often preferred for people with certain specific conditions:

  • Mechanical heart valves: It is the go-to choice for individuals with artificial heart valves due to its proven efficacy in preventing clot formation on these devices.
  • Severe kidney failure: For those with significant kidney impairment, Warfarin remains a safer and more manageable option compared to newer alternatives.
  • Liver disease: It can be a preferred choice for individuals with liver issues, though careful monitoring is essential.
  • Certain clotting disorders (thrombophilia): For specific genetic or acquired conditions that increase clotting risk, Warfarin provides reliable protection.

A key characteristic of Warfarin is its long-lasting protection, which can extend for several days. However, it requires regular blood tests (INR monitoring) to ensure the dosage is correct and to minimize bleeding risks.

Direct Oral Anticoagulants (DOACs)

This newer class of anticoagulants includes medications like rivaroxaban (Xarelto®), apixaban (Eliquis®), dabigatran (Pradaxa®), and edoxaban (Savaysa®). DOACs have gained popularity for their convenience. They generally have much shorter half-lives compared to Warfarin, meaning they are cleared from the body more quickly. This often translates to:

  • Less frequent monitoring: Unlike Warfarin, DOACs typically do not require routine blood tests to adjust dosage.
  • Fewer dietary restrictions: Their effectiveness is not significantly impacted by vitamin K intake, which simplifies dietary management.
  • Common uses: They are frequently prescribed for stroke prevention in non-valvular AFib, and for the treatment and prevention of DVT and PE.

Antiplatelets

These medications work by preventing platelets (tiny blood cells) from sticking together and forming clots. They are commonly used to prevent heart attacks and strokes in people with a history of cardiovascular disease. Examples include aspirin and clopidogrel (Plavix®).

Factors Determining the "Best" Choice

The decision for which blood thinner is "best" is a complex one, made by a healthcare professional after careful consideration of several factors:

  • Underlying condition: Is it for atrial fibrillation, DVT, PE, mechanical heart valves, or a clotting disorder?
  • Risk of bleeding: A patient's personal history of bleeding, fall risk, and other medications that might increase bleeding.
  • Kidney and liver function: These organs process and eliminate medications, so their health significantly impacts drug choice and dosage.
  • Drug interactions: Other medications a patient is taking can interact with blood thinners.
  • Patient preference and adherence: Simplicity of regimen (e.g., once-daily dosing vs. twice-daily), need for monitoring, and lifestyle factors.
  • Cost and insurance coverage: Accessibility of the medication can be a factor.

Important Considerations

Choosing a blood thinner is a personalized medical decision. It's crucial to:

  • Consult a healthcare professional: Never self-prescribe or change your blood thinner medication without medical guidance. Your doctor will assess your unique health profile, weigh the benefits against the risks, and select the most appropriate treatment for you.
  • Adhere to prescribed dosage: Take your medication exactly as prescribed to ensure its effectiveness and safety.
  • Be aware of bleeding signs: Understand the potential side effects, such as increased bruising or bleeding, and know when to seek medical attention. Learn more about living with blood thinners from reputable health organizations.

The "best" blood thinner is truly the one that is best suited for you, under the careful guidance of your healthcare provider.
